le=Host(``) & Path(`/notifications/hub`) var/run/docker.sock:/var/run/docker.sock:ro I'm posting my configurations below if they're of any help. I'm guessing that the issue is that since I'm using HTTPS, I'm actually going through the Internet and back to my server to reach the bitwarden container, hence using my public IP, so Traefik sees this request coming from a public IP (please tell me if I got it right or if that's not what happens when using HTTPS).ĭoes anyone know if there's a solution to this problem? I couldn't find anything elsewhere. I configured a middleware using "ipWhiteList" to specify the whitelisted private IP source ranges but the result is that I'm now not able to access the container anymore (via ), it says "forbidden". Now I want to be able to access that container only from private IP ranges, or in other words, I don't want the Internet to be able to access my selfhosted password manager (even though it should be safe) and only access it from my LAN (or VPN when I'm not home). This container requires HTTPS to work correctly, so I'm using Let's Encrypt to provide certificates. I have my Raspberry on which I setup Traefik v2 as a reverse proxy for my only Docker container, which is running bitwarden_rs. ".Hello, I'm wondering if there is a way to limit access to a Docker container only to private IP ranges when using HTTPS. * Say N if you are working on a remote or headless machineĮnter verification code> YOUR_VERIFICATION_CODEĬonfigure this as a Shared Drive (Team Drive)? "le=hostregexp(``.Įnter a string value. "/var/run/docker.sock:/var/run/docker.sock:ro" # -api.insecure # Don't do that in production
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|